“A Month Crowned with Goodness”
Special 1st December Morning Devotionals for the Church


📖 Scripture Reading: Psalm 65:11

“You crown the year with Your goodness, and Your paths drip with abundance.”

💒 Devotional Thought:

As we rise on the first morning of December, we pause as a church to recognize that God has carried us through eleven months of victories, challenges, miracles, and lessons. Today is not just the beginning of another month—it's an invitation to look back with gratitude and look forward with expectation.

Psalm 65:11 reminds us of a powerful truth:
God doesn’t just fill our year; He crowns it.
He places His goodness over it like a royal seal, marking it with favor, mercy, and divine orchestration.

December often brings both reflection and pressure—but God says this month will drip with abundance. That doesn’t only mean material blessings. It means:

  • Abundance of peace in anxious hearts

  • Abundance of strength for weary souls

  • Abundance of grace for every family

  • Abundance of hope for every tomorrow

As a church, we choose to enter this month not with fear or hurry, but with faith.
We declare that God has appointed December to be a month of completion, renewal, and breakthroughs.

Even if the year felt heavy, God can still crown it beautifully.
Even if some prayers seem unanswered, God can still fulfill them suddenly.
Even if we feel tired, God can renew strength we thought we lost.

This morning, we align our hearts with the truth:
What God begins, He completes. What He covers, He blesses. What He crowns, He fills with purpose.
